1. A method for resource reservation performed by a terminal device in connection with sidelink transmission on an unlicensed spectrum, the method comprising:
performing Listen Before Talk (LBT) on the unlicensed spectrum; and
sending sidelink control information after the LBT is successful, wherein the sidelink control information is used to indicate N transmission resources reserved for a first transport block, and an upper limit of N is an integer greater than 3,
wherein the sidelink control information comprises a first period field, and the first period field is used to indicate a first time-domain period between periodic transmission resource groups reserved for the first transport block, the transmission resource group comprises at least one transmission resource indicated by a time-domain resource assignment field and/or a frequency-domain resource assignment field,
wherein the sidelink control information further comprises a first period parameter field, and the first period parameter field is used to indicate the number of reserved periods of the transmission resource group, and
wherein the sidelink control information is used to indicate transmission resources reserved for M transport blocks, the M transport blocks comprise the first transport block, and M is an integer greater than 1, the sidelink control information further comprises a second period field and a second period parameter field, the second period field is used to indicate a second time-domain period between periodic transmission resource sets reserved for the M transport blocks, and the second period parameter field is used to indicate the number of reserved periods of the transmission resource set.
